rice stir-ins
Easy, Cheesy Rice: Add butter and parmesan cheese to hot, cooked rice.
Emerald Isle: Add peas and finely chopped fresh mint to hot, cooked rice.
Baked, but not Potato: Add crumbled bacon and sour cream to hot, cooked rice.
Lemon Zinger: Add butter, fresh lemon juice and lemon zest to hot, cooked rice
How Sweet It Is: Add cinnamon, sugar and butter to hot, cooked rice.
Maui Wowi: Add crushed pineapple and green bell pepper slices to hot, cooked rice.
Sesame Treat: Add toasted sesame seeds, sesame oil and thinly sliced green onions to hot, cooked rice.
Country Bumpkin: Add cream gravy to hot, cooked rice.
Health Nut: Add toasted sunflower seeds and raisins to hot, cooked rice.
Dracula's 'Shroom: Add mushrooms and garlic sauteed in butter to hot, cooked rice.
Gardener's Delight: Add chopped fresh basil, chopped tomatoes and fresh corn-off-the-cob to hot, cooked rice.
Leek Freak: Add butter and cooked leeks to hot, cooked rice.
Chantilly Rice: Add chanterelles, dried apricots and toasted almonds to hot, cooked rice.
Cantonese Please: Add broccoli flowerets, sesame oil, chopped toasted peanuts or cashews to hot, cooked rice.
Pass the Parmesan, Peas: Add garlic sauteed in butter, peas and
parmesan cheese to hot, cooked rice.
Polish BBQ: Add kielbasa sausage and barbecue sauce to hot, cooked rice.
Unkissable Crunch: Add sauteed garlic and onions, and toasted walnuts to hot, cooked rice.
Moo Goo Rice: Add sauteed mushrooms, snow peas and sliced water chestnuts to hot, cooked rice
Mama Mia: Add tomato basil sauce, cooked zucchini and Italian sausage to hot, cooked rice. Top with parmesan cheese.
Rice Ole: Add black beans, minced red onion, chopped bell pepper,
chopped cilantro, and vinaigrette to hot, cooked rice.
Corn on the Range: Add corn and barbecue sauce to hot, cooked rice
Southern Rice: Add cooked okra and stewed tomatoes to hot, cooked rice.
Porky Peas: Add crumbled bacon and peas to hot, cooked rice.
Hoppin' John: Add black-eyed peas and sliced green onions to hot,
cooked rice.
Veggy Medley: Add garbanzo beans, shredded carrots, ripe olives,
parsley, and ricotta cheese to hot, cooked rice. Top with parmesan cheese.
Mock Apple Cobbler: Add sliced apples, cinnamon, brown sugar, chopped nuts, and vanilla yogurt to hot, cooked rice.
Rice Parmigana: Add mixed vegetables, your favorite spice or herb, butter, and parmesan cheese to hot, cooked rice.
South of the Border: Add diced tomatoes, sliced green onions,
shredded monterey jack cheese and chopped cilantro to hot, cooked rice.
Hearty Rice: Add marinated artichoke hearts and grated Parmesan
cheese to hot, cooked rice.
Little Bit of Italy: Add asparagus tips, toasted pine nuts, red and
yellow peppers to hot, cooked rice. Top with Parmesan cheese.
U.S.S. Rice: Add naval orange slices, chopped red onions or
scallions, and vinaigrette dressing to hot, cooked rice.
Feeling Slightly Mexican: Add fresh avocado, tomato chunks, fresh
cilantro, and lots of lemon
Steam-it-Up: Add steamed zucchini and carrots, butter, parmesan
cheese to hot, cooked rice.
Nuts about Garlic: Add sauteed garlic and toasted pinenuts to hot,
cooked rice.
Let's Salsa: Add cooked beans, salsa and shredded cheese to hot, cooked rice.
Trail Blazer: Add yogurt and fresh fruit to hot, cooked rice. Top
with granola.
Pooh Bear's Favorite: Add milk, raisins, a little sugar and a dash of
vanilla to hot, cooked rice. Simmer until thickened. Drizzle with
honey.
Farmer's Scramble: Add scrambled eggs, sausage and green onions to hot, cooked rice.
Rice Cream: Add vanilla ice cream, dash of cinnamon to hot, cooked rice.
Indian Gold: Cook rice with a pinch of saffron. Add cooked green
beans.
Tea-Time: For extra flavor, toss an herbal tea bag into the water
while rice cooks.
Beefed-Up Rice: Cook rice in beef broth. Add sauteed onions, cashews, and raisins. Top with green onions
Rice Worth Crowing About: Cook rice in chicken stock. Add sauteed onions, mushrooms, green pepper, and toasted pine nuts.
It's Greek to Me: Cook rice in chicken broth with chopped onion and a clove of minced garlic. Fold in feta cheese and chopped parsley.
Curry in a Hurry: Saute curry and turmeric in saucepan. Add rice and stir to coat. Add water and cook rice. Top with chopped peanuts or cashews.
Zest of the Best: Saute uncooked rice, dried currants and orange zest in butter. Here's one I used to do a lot for
a health food breakfast:
to cooked brown rice add:
canned crushed pineapple
organic raisins
walnuts
heat in a small saucepan
sprinkle on a little cinnamon
